TabTrade - What Traders Should Know

Tab Trade - What It Is



TabTrade opened in March 2026. Online broker incorporated in Saint Lucia, regulated by the Financial Services Regulatory Authority. The founder is Benjamin Boulter. Previously, he was on the executive team at BlackBull Markets, an well-known broker.



The BlackBull connection tells you something. It means the leadership knows how a proper broker operates. Does not guarantee anything. But more reassuring than someone with no brokerage experience.



The broker opened with Equinix LD4/LD5 connectivity. Same data centres prime brokers run on. Most new brokers starts with a white-label MT4 setup. TabTrade went the other way. Unusual for a new broker.



The instrument list: FX, stock indices, metals, oil, energies, softs, stock CFDs, crypto, ETFs. Over 1,000 instruments. For a platform that is a few months old, that coverage is solid.



What You Trade On



Available: MT5, cTrader by Spotware, and a WebTrader. Both MT5 and cTrader from a single account. Many commit to either MT5 or cTrader. Access to both matters. Pick what suits your style.



MT5 is the default. Complete charts, EAs, huge user base. If you have traded on MetaTrader before, it is familiar territory.



cTrader is the cleaner option. Better depth of market. More responsive charts. Native automated trading. Many people prefer it after using both.



FIX API is there for algo traders but is only on the VIP account ($25,000 deposit). TradingView is said to be coming. That should be a good addition when it arrives.



Costs



Three account types: Standard, Edge, VIP.



Standard account. 1.0 pip spreads. No commission. Straightforward. Zero deposit requirement. Suits beginners.



Edge. True raw pricing from 0.0 pips on average. Commission of $3.50 per side. Total cost: raw spread plus $7 per full lot. On EUR/USD, the raw spread is often a fraction of a pip. Meaning your real cost can sit under half a pip. That is hard to beat for a broker with no minimum deposit. Most brokers that have spreads this tight ask for $500 or $1,000 upfront. This broker does not.



VIP. $25k to open. FIX API, faster fills, tailored rates. Not relevant to most retail traders. Skip it unless you move real size.



Infrastructure



The speed is the thing TabTrade actually does something different. Equinix LD4/LD5. Sub-30ms execution on Edge. Under 20ms on VIP. That is institutional numbers. Most retail brokers quote 100ms to 300ms.



Does it matter? If you scalp, yes. The gap between a 30ms fill and a 200ms fill is catching the move or missing it. If you hold positions longer, it matters less. But the fact that the infrastructure is there. That signals they are not cutting corners on the tech.



Put together that infrastructure with raw spreads at $3.50 per side and the overall offering holds up. Not many platforms with no minimum deposit offer execution like this.



The FSRA Question



Here is the part you need to be straight about. The broker is licensed by Saint Lucia's FSRA. That is tier-3. No FCA. No fund protection scheme. If operating without FCA or ASIC oversight is a dealbreaker, look elsewhere. Lots of tier-1 alternatives out there.



That said. The person running it came from BlackBull Markets, a proper broker. The server placement costs real money. Fly-by-night platforms do not invest in Equinix connectivity. None of this replace tier-1 regulation. But inform how you think about it.



The trade-off: you give up tier-1 protection. For that: high leverage, raw pricing from 0.0 pips, no minimum deposit, fast fills. Whether that makes sense comes down to your priorities.
